Interface DslValidator
-
- All Known Implementing Classes:
BatchProcessingQuerySchemaValidator,GetByIdSchemaValidator,ReclassificationQuerySchemaValidator,SelectMultipleSchemaValidator,SelectSingleSchemaValidator,UpdateBulkSchemaValidator,UpdateByIdSchemaValidator,UpdateMultipleSchemaValidator
public interface DslValidatorValidator for Dsl queries.
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voidvalidate(com.fasterxml.jackson.databind.JsonNode dsl)Validate a dsl query
-
-
-
Method Detail
-
validate
void validate(com.fasterxml.jackson.databind.JsonNode dsl) throws ValidationExceptionValidate a dsl query- Parameters:
dsl- dsl query- Throws:
java.lang.IllegalArgumentException- dsl empty or nullValidationException- thrown if dsl query is not valid
-
-